Abstract

The utility model is related to a kind of suspender tension auxiliary devices, including tensioning platform, the tensioning platform is equipped with through the tensioning platform and connect the force application apparatus of setting with sunpender anchor head, the tensioning platform includes the bearing plate for supporting the force application apparatus and the undertaking column positioned at the bearing plate bottom, the undertaking column is solid steel column, and the tensioning mesa base is equipped with the levelling device that bottom is mutually abutted with the arch rib;During suspender tension, by using solid steel column as column is accepted, tensioning platform overall stiffness and intensity can be effectively improved, and supporting & stablizing, security performance is high, can be effectively prevented from during support, spike be bent, cause support shakiness cause safety accident there is a phenomenon where.

Description

A kind of suspender tension auxiliary device
Technical field
The utility model is related to Bridge Construction apparatus fields, more particularly, to a kind of suspender tension auxiliary device.
Background technology
Bowstring arch bridge is high order redundant structure, is that will encircle to combine with beam by sunpender comprising arch rib, sunpender And crossbeam;It is high to the construction requirement of sunpender and due to being influenced by bridge structure form, load bearing capacity etc..
If the Chinese patent of Publication No. " CN107034788A " discloses a kind of suspender tension device and its construction method, Including a footstock and a tension rod, the footstock includes the upper padding plate and lower bolster of fixed setting, between upper padding plate and lower bolster It is fixedly connected by column, reinforcing plate is welded between adjacent upright posts, and formed between the upper padding plate and lower bolster and accommodate sky Between, the upper padding plate is equipped with tensioning hole, and the lower bolster is equipped with the notch to match for the connecting seat with sunpender;The tensioning Bar passes through the tensioning hole and stretches into the accommodation space, and the tension rod bottom structure is adapted to the connection with sunpender The connection of seat top;It further include a force application apparatus being installed on the footstock.
A kind of suspender tension device disclosed in above-mentioned technical proposal and its arrangement and method for construction fill force by footstock It sets and is supported, wherein footstock combines to be formed by upper padding plate and lower bolster, is fixedly connected by column between upper lower bolster, During drawing, force application apparatus applies pressure that is vertical and being directed toward upper padding plate on upper padding plate, and when load deficiency, column is easy to become Shape is bent, and is impacted to stretch-draw effect.
Utility model content
The purpose of this utility model is to provide a kind of suspender tension auxiliary devices, and force can steadily be supported by having The characteristics of device.
The above-mentioned technical purpose of the utility model technical scheme is that:
A kind of suspender tension auxiliary device, including tensioning platform, the tensioning platform, which is equipped with, runs through the tensioning platform And the force application apparatus of setting is connect with sunpender anchor head, the tensioning platform includes supporting the bearing plate of the force application apparatus and being located at The undertaking column of the bearing plate bottom, the undertaking column are solid steel column, and the tensioning mesa base is equipped with bottom and the arch The levelling device that rib mutually abuts.
By using above-mentioned technical proposal, during suspender tension, by using solid steel column as column is accepted, tensioning is flat Platform overall stiffness and intensity can be effectively improved, and supported and more stablized, and security performance is high, can be effectively prevented from branch During support, accept column bending, cause to support shakiness cause safety accident there is a phenomenon where, and by the setting of levelling device, So that in carrying out stretching process, the bearing plate of tensioning platform top surface remains horizontal, avoids in stretching process, bearing plate The phenomenon that inclination, force application apparatus applies inclined pulling force to sunpender, sunpender is caused to be bent, occurs.

Specific implementation mode
The utility model is described in further detail below in conjunction with attached drawing.
A kind of suspender tension auxiliary device, as shown in Figure 1, including tensioning platform 1, tensioning platform 1 is equipped with for hanging Bar 4 applies stressed force application apparatus 2, and here, tensioning platform 1 includes the bearing plate 12 of support force application apparatus 2, in the present embodiment, Bearing plate 12 used is the bearing plate 12 of Steel material, and in order to avoid in stretching process, bearing plate 12 is bent, as shown in Figure 1, holding About 12 both sides of fishplate bar are equipped with the reinforcing rib 13 being staggered;12 bottom of bearing plate is equipped with the undertaking column 11 of support bearing plate 12, Here, it is solid steel column to accept column 11, and accepts column 11 and be threaded in the surrounding edge of bearing plate 12, and accept column 11 with Bearing plate 12 is welded and fixed.In this way, accepting column 11 by being used as by solid steel column so that in stretching process, can more stablize Ground is supported bearing plate 12, and security performance is high, and during avoiding support, accepting the bending of column 11 leads to safety accident The phenomenon that.
Tensioning platform 1 needs that the bearing plate 12 of its top surface is kept to remain horizontal, such as Fig. 1 in carrying out stub procedure It is shown, levelling device 3 is equipped with below column 11 accepting, in the present embodiment, levelling device 3 includes being arranged accepting 11 bottom of column Leveling steel plate 31 and the abutting plate 32 mutually abutted with lower section arch rib 5 abut and are hingedly equipped with several pilot pins 33 on plate 32, positioning Bolt 33 is threaded on leveling steel plate 31 and is arranged in a mutually vertical manner with leveling steel plate 31.In this way, in stretching process, pass through adjusting The angle that pilot pin 33 is exchanged between plain plate 31 and horizontal plane is adjusted so that leveling steel plate 31 keeps horizontal positioned.
In order to facilitate leveling steel plate 31 and the adjusting for abutting angle between plate 32, as shown in Figure 1, in the present embodiment, positioning It is two groups that bolt 33, which is divided to, and is arranged in a mutually vertical manner with 5 tangential direction of arch rib with the line of group pilot pin 33, and leveling steel plate 31 is equipped with Two levelling tubes 311 being arranged in a mutually vertical manner.In this way, when carrying out angular adjustment, it is only necessary to be adjusted for same group of pilot pin 33 Section, so that adjustment process is more convenient.
5 top surface of arch rib is arc-shaped, and circular arc is not of uniform size, is fixed on arch rib 5 to abut plate 32, such as Fig. 1 institutes Show, in the present embodiment, abutting plate 32 and being equipped with the fixing device being fixed on arch rib 5, here, fixing device includes setting The extension board 321 of 5 side of arch rib is directed toward on abutting plate 32, extension board 321 is located at the both sides of 5 tangential direction of arch rib, extension board Several fixing bolts 322 being connected on arch rib 5 are threaded on 321.In this way, be connected to by fixing bolt 322 it is right on arch rib 5 It abuts plate 32 to be fixed, avoiding it from sliding in stretching process causes leveling steel plate 31 that cannot keep horizontal.
In the present embodiment, as shown in Fig. 2, used force application apparatus 2 includes the tool pull rod 21 through bearing plate 12, work Tool 21 bottom of pull rod and the anchor head of sunpender 4 are fixed to each other, and here, 21 bottom of tool pull rod is weldingly fixed on the top of 4 anchor head of sunpender Portion, force application apparatus 2 further include the single Shu Zhangla oil overholds 22 being arranged on bearing plate 12, and single Shu Zhangla oil overholds 22 are set in tool drawing The periphery of bar 21, the top of single Shu Zhangla oil overholds 22 are equipped with the limited block 221 being fixed to each other with tool pull rod 21.In this way, tensioning In the process, first there is the pressure of single Shu Zhangla oil overholds 22 straight up to the application of limited block 221, then applied pressure by the transmission of power It is added on sunpender 4, to realize the tensioning to sunpender 4.
Operation principle:
Levelling device 3 is first fixed on to the top for the sunpender 4 for needing tensioning, and by pilot pin 33 exchange plain plate 31 into Row Level tune;Tensioning platform 1 is placed on leveling steel plate 31;By tool pull rod 21 through tensioning platform 1 and by tool pull rod 21 bottom is welded and fixed with the anchor head on sunpender 4;Single Shu Zhangla oil overholds 22 are arranged in 21 outside of tool pull rod, and are drawn in tool Limited block 221 is fixed on bar 21, completes the installation of auxiliary device;Apply pressure by single Shu Zhangla oil overholds 22 and realizes tensioning, After the completion of drawing, the weld between tool pull rod 21 and sunpender 4 is cut off, completes the tensioning of sunpender 4.
